MMUHX Mutual Fund (MFS Utilities Fund Class R3) is managed by MFS Investment Management with $136.1M in net assets. MMUHX expense ratio is 1.00%, holding 45 positions across sectors including Utilities. Inception date: 2005-04-01.

MMUHX performance shows a YTD return of 6.50%. The 1-year return is 10.39% and the 5-year return is 7.72%. MMUHX dividend yield stands at 3.87%, paid quarterly.
